Eight ideas for the Fourth

The Fourth of July weekend is upon us and downtown San Diego has no shortage of activities to choose from. Take your pick: 1. The Padres will host the Houston Astros at PETCO Park at 1:05 p.m. The first 10,000 children, age 14 and under, will receive a Padres T-shirt. For tickets visit www.padres.com. 2. Apple Pie Fourth of July on the USS Midway will begin at 6 p.m. The museum will remain open through the fireworks display on the bay. There will be live music and kid-friendly activities such as bobbing for apples, face painting, a jump house and more. For more information and to purchase tickets visit www.midway.org. 3. Reenactments of the first salute, the first international recognition of the American flag, will take place at the Maritime Museum at the beginning and end of the fireworks show. The museum will also offer a barbecue, sailing on the Californian and cannon firings. For cost information and tickets visit www.sdmaritime.org. 4. Summer Pops at the Embarcadero Marina Park South will feature Marvin Hamlisch conducting a patriotic performance of Broadway hits, marches and a salute to the military. The performance begins at 7:30 p.m. For tickets call (619) 235-0804 or visit www.sandieogsymphony.org. 5. The 10th annual Port of San Diego Big Bay Boom Fireworks Show will begin at 9 p.m. and consists of four simultaneous shows around the bay. Seaport Village, the Embarcadero, Harbor Island and Shelter Island offer spectacular views of the annual favorite. For more information visit www.portofsandiego.org. 6. San Diego Harbor Excursions will offer special Fourth of July holiday dinner and spectator cruises on the bay. Watch the Big Bay Boom from the deck of one of the Harbor Excursion’s vessels. For more information visit www.sdhe.com. 7. Hornblower Cruises will offer a champagne brunch cruise as well as a dinner cruise topped off with views of the fireworks. For more information visit www.hornblower.com. 8. Altitude Sky Lounge at the Marriott Gaslamp, offering views of fireworks, will be rocking to club beats supplied by DJ D-Skwiz during the day and DJ Ramsey into the night. For more information visit www.altitudeskylounge.com.
